Summary
Reveal smooth, radiant skin with VOESH’s Resurfacing Sugar Scrub. Sugar, red bean, and plant AHAs exfoliate to brighten, while nourishing oils lock in lasting hydration.
Benefits
- Triple-action scrub with sugar, red bean, & AHA exfoliates, brightens, & nourishes skin
- Helps tighten and refine the look of pores
- Glow-boosting botanical oils lock in moisture for lasting hydration & radiance
- Black Tea & Rosé is a bright, sparkly scent that features notes of apple, peach, orange, & rose balanced by soft musk, amber, & vanilla
Key Ingredients
- Red Bean, used for generations in Korean rituals, detoxifies & provides a glass-skin glow
- Sugar buffs & brightens for soft, renewed skin
- Plant-Derived AHA stimulates cell turnover to smooth texture & brighten tone
- Botanical Oil Blend nourishes & leaves skin visibly more radiant
- Baechu Biome Complex™ is a vegan probiotic that balances the microbiome & strengthens the skin barrier
Research Results
- 88% saw smoother skin instantly
- 85% saw improvement in dry, flaky, or ashy skin
- 85% reported improvement in skin texture
- *Based on a 2-week clinical study of 34 women with once-a-day use.

Step 1: Apply a generous amount to damp skin & massage in circular motions.
Step 2: Rinse thoroughly & pat dry.
Step 3: For best results, use daily & follow with a moisturizer, such as VOESH's Body Balm.

I received this product for free from the brand in exchange for writing this review. I have enjoyed using this resurfacing sugar scrub for the past few weeks. I have used it about 2-3 times per week on my arms and legs and found that the skin does feel smoother. The scrub is not too aggressive and works well on my sometime sensitive skin. The scent was pleasant and not overwhelming at all.

I used this scrub before I shaved and it worked well as an exfoliant. There were different particle sizes, sugar that dissolved & other larger particles that didn't dissolve. I enjoyed the expanded descriptions for the ingredients making them all straightforward & easy to understand.

I typically use this product after initial cleansing with an oil-based cleanser. While I loved the gritty texture and thought it did a great job exfoliating my skin, I didn't care for the scent. The product also felt a bit drying after rinse.

I really enjoyed the Resurfacing Sugar Drip (Fig & Amber). The packaging and amount of product are great, and the thick texture feels rich and high quality. The sugar cubes exfoliate well without hurting the skin, and when water is added the scrub turns almost milky, making it very gentle to use. The scent is pleasant, with amber being the dominant note over fig. I also like that it includes ingredients inspired by Korean skincare, like red beans, which are known for helping improve the health and appearance of the skin. I would recommend it to others who enjoy gentle but effective body scrubs.
